INTRODUCTION - PROCEDURAL AND CONSTITUTIONAL MATTERS

Introduction

1. The Hundred and Sixth Session of the Council was held in Rome from 30 May to 1 June 1994 under the Chairmanship of José Ramón López Portillo, Independent Chairman of the Council.

Adoption of the Agenda and Timetable1

2. The Agenda and Timetable of the session were adopted with the addition of a sub-item, under item 8, Any Other Business, entitled "FAO Fiftieth Anniversary Celebrations, Quebec City (Canada) 1995". The Agenda is reproduced in Appendix A to this Report.

Election of Three Vice-Chairmen, and Designation of the Chairman and Members of the Drafting Committee2

3. The Council elected three Vice-Chairmen for its Session: I.F. Maria Dos Anjos (Angola), Ms Concha Marina Ramírez de López (Honduras), Ms Mária Kadlecikova (Slovakia).

4. The Council elected Per H. Grue (Norway) as Chairman of the Drafting Committee and, as a special arrangement for this session, the following membership: Australia, Burkina Faso, Egypt, Hungary, Japan, Malaysia, Norway, Spain/Sri Lanka, Swaziland, Syria, Thailand, Trinidad and Tobago, United States of America and Venezuela.

Invitations to Non-Member Nations to attend FAO Sessions3

5. In accordance with paragraph B-l of the "Statement of Principles relating to the Granting of Observer Status to Nations " ,4 the Council considered the request made by the Russian Federation and Ukraine to attend as observers the Hundred and Sixth Session of the Council, and approved their participation.

6. In accordance with paragraph B-2 of the aforementioned Statement of Principles, the Council agreed to the Director-General's proposal to invite Ukraine to participate as an observer in the Third Technical Consultation of AGRIS and CARIS Participating Centres, Rome, 6-10 June 1994.

7. The Council was also informed that since its Hundred and Fifth Session, the Director-General, on being so requested, had extended invitations to Ukraine and the Russian Federation to attend as observers the Eighteenth Session of the European Inland Fisheries Advisory Commission (EIFAC), Rome, 17-25 May 1994 (FI-727).

Changes in Representation of Member Nations on the Programme and Finance Committees5

8. As provided for in Rule XXVI-4(a) of the General Rules of the Organization (GRO), the Council was advised that Ms Sabria Boukadoum, Counsellor,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the People's Democratic Republic of Algeria, had replaced Ms Amina Boudjelti as the Government Representative for the Sixty-ninth Session of the Programme Committee.

9. As provided for in Rule XXVII-4(a) of the General Rules of the Organization (GRO), the Council was advised that Mr Abdesselem Arifi, Alternate Permanent Representative of the Kingdom of Morocco to FAO, had been designated as the new Representative of Morocco on the Finance Committee, as from the Seventy-eighth Session.

Calendar of FAO Governing Bodies and Other Main Sessions 19946

10. The Council was informed of and approved the Calendar of FAO Governing Bodies and Other Main Sessions 1994 as reproduced in Appendix D to this Report.
